Immunocore Holdings (IMCR) Non-Current Receivables (2020 - 2023)
Immunocore Holdings' Non-Current Receivables history spans 4 years, with the latest figure at $63.2 million for Q3 2023.
- On a quarterly basis, Non-Current Receivables rose 30.86% to $63.2 million in Q3 2023 year-over-year; TTM through Sep 2023 was $63.2 million, a 30.86% increase, with the full-year FY2022 number at $54.8 million, up 167.25% from a year prior.
- Non-Current Receivables hit $63.2 million in Q3 2023 for Immunocore Holdings, up from $60.6 million in the prior quarter.
- Over the last five years, Non-Current Receivables for IMCR hit a ceiling of $63.2 million in Q3 2023 and a floor of $12.2 million in Q1 2021.
- Historically, Non-Current Receivables has averaged $36.6 million across 4 years, with a median of $39.5 million in 2022.
- Biggest five-year swings in Non-Current Receivables: skyrocketed 225.35% in 2022 and later surged 30.86% in 2023.
- Tracing IMCR's Non-Current Receivables over 4 years: stood at $13.6 million in 2020, then soared by 51.03% to $20.5 million in 2021, then skyrocketed by 167.25% to $54.8 million in 2022, then rose by 15.32% to $63.2 million in 2023.
